The Patriots claimed linebacker Christian Elliss off waivers from the Eagles on Thursday. To make room for the arrival of Elliss, the Patriots waived operating again Ty Montgomery on Friday.
The Patriots signed Montgomery to a two-year, $3.6 million deal within the 2022 offseason, however this season, he has solely three dashing makes an attempt for 9 yards, 5 receptions for 40 yards and 9 kickoff returns for 219 yards. Montgomery has performed 42 offensive snaps and 198 on particular groups this season.
The Patriots claimed operating again JaMycal Hasty off waivers from Jacksonville on Nov. 13, and he’ll function the third operating again on the 53-player roster. Rhamondre Stevenson missed Thursday’s sport with a excessive ankle sprain, although, leaving solely Ezekiel Elliott and Hasty because the wholesome operating backs on the lively roster. Kevin Harris is on the observe squad.
Montgomery, 30, has performed for the Packers, Ravens, Jets, Saints and Patriots since Green Bay made him a third-round choose in 2015.
